The veil is lifted gradually. The Labor Inspectorate, in charge of investigating the wave of suicides that has struck France Telecom, has submitted its report to the prosecutor of Paris, February 4 last. According to Le Parisien / Today in France this Saturday, this 82-page report clearly denounced the "political restructuring" implemented by the former management team of the operator in 2006.

The warning had been given

Based on the survey conducted by the firm Technologia since December 14 last, with 500 employees of France Telecom, the labor inspector, Sylvie Catala said that the former management has been warned "repeatedly" effects produced by its management policy of "health workers".Doctors labor union representatives, regional fund Medicare and "even justice" have sounded the alarm since 2006.

Neither worked. Management has maintained the course and put in place its plan Next, aimed at "improving the efficiency, effectiveness and productivity" of France Telecom. By what means? The removal of 22,000 jobs in three years and the transfer of 10,000 people to regions and / or different jobs.In its indictment, the inspection work is directly involved three people: Didier Lombard, the former CEO of the group replaced by Stéphane Richard 1 March but retains chairmanship non-operational, Louis-Pierre Wenes, former director Operations France and Olivier Barberot, former director of human resources, both landed in the heart of the storm check cash advance .

The reorganization at any price

Thus, the inspector cites including about Olivier Barberot required to Staff Group in 2006, referring to the plane Next: "I will have failed if we do not the 22,000 departures. For the group, is 7 billion of cash flow. "The reorganization should be done.At the risk of certain employees remain "at the roadside," according to a formula used by Louis-Pierre Wenes at a convention this year 2006.

The conclusion of the inspection work is final. The organization of work implemented by the management of France Telecom is "likely to cause serious harm to the health of workers, it is written in the document shown by Le Parisien / Today in France. An accusation which excludes the regional operator. The latter "have merely applied the methods and decisions taken at the highest level of the group."

This questioning of France Telecom, which has complained about fifty suicides since 2008, echoed in another report from the inspection work on the floor of Besancon in January, following the suicide of an employee in the Doubs in August last.His verdict: "homicide by imprudence".

The day the crazy rumor mill has picked

Posted by admin on January 9th, 2010

The meeting had yet begun in a friendly atmosphere, around a few cakes of kings. Tuesday morning, the eighth floor of the MEDEF, after an hour of quiet trade on the carbon tax and social negotiations, the clash occurred without anyone waiting on the highly technical issue tenders Association fund management integration of persons with disabilities. Clash between the two numbers 2 "tie" of the organization, Jean-Charles Simon and Helen Molinari, whose disagreement was notorious. For some, Jean-Charles Simon had treated Helen Molinari of "idiot" and "incompetent" before slamming the door. The person himself, swears that he kept his composure. "I said what she said was false then I left the meeting," he promises, that confirms a witness.

What does not yet know the participants is that they will never again see Jean-Charles Simon.For him, this incident is the straw that broke a vase too full for several weeks. The evidence was that Laurence Parisot, despite assurances that he swears that he obtained in December, no desire to change the allocation of tasks with Helen Molinari. Back down in his office, he sends his resignation by email to the president of MEDEF, asking not to his notice three months, and leaves the building. Definitely. This email, Laurence Parisot discovered in the early afternoon and will act without a call to his ex-delegate-general to understand the decision or seek to hold him.

Things might have stayed there and the MEDEF, after the resignation proved by Le Figaro, could minimize the event. But Wednesday morning, the machine goes.In a statement to AFP, Jean-Charles Simon recalls failures "in decision-making and organizational roles, ranging up to criticize" the professionalism of the leadership "of MEDEF. The employers' organization responds by accusing him, in a statement at your unusually steep "having conducted his own end after a spectacular incident," and provides "support to internal teams Medef that have been proven these unusual methods. " The break was complete.

The food industry leaves the MEDEF

Posted by admin on December 17th, 2009

The National Association of food industries (Ania) decided this morning after three hours of heated debate, leaving the MEDEF, it was learned from corroborating sources.

After your secret ballot procedure rarrissime the board took this decision by 18 votes against 12. The Ania MEDEF considers that it "pays" too little regard to the amount of annual dues (over 600,000 euros).

Yet no decision to join another employer organization has been taken. The departure of a large federation, which had supported Laurence Parisot when she presented herself at the head of MEDEF, is a blow to the boss of bosses.

The owner of Ania, Jean-René Buisson, will hold a press briefing at 15 am explaining the decision of its directors.
